Ground pound build is just better than wing of fury?
When Saber did update the jet pack dodge build with the other perks to regain charge I was overjoyed and switched right away. Learned to dodge properly and weaving through big waves to kill enemies.
But then I realised I lose a lot in damage from ground pound and I can still regain charge for perfect dodges with the jetpack so I switched back to ground pound.
So far I have noticed a MAJOR increase of my survivability and damage potential. I use exclusively the heroic hammer (because bonk).
So far with the wing of fury build:
- If I mess up a dodge I lose the charge and do some damage
- If I succeed in dodging sometimes I don't get back my charge
- If I jetpack dodge the attack and the enemy goes to execute mode I don't get my charge back
- Refund charge after a jetpack dash attack is wildly inconsistent. I have to make sure there is an enemy behind I can hit. Rarely, I can hit the enemy I just went through
- Ground pound is significantly weaker
Whereas with the ground pound build I can nuke things while still enjoying the dodge mechanics.
- Missing a dodge still happens and I don't do the damage, I just use the jetpack dodge on red attacks and I can't cancel in time. Fair.
- Still happens, but I now tend to just do the normal dodge.
- Can't have the enemy in execute if I don't do damage with the dodge, much better.
- Can't use the refund charge perk.
- +100% damage and 10% ability charge per fill, proper xenos nuke which you can spam when there are a lot of enemies.
Am I missing something with the wing of fury build?
